My high carbon steel full tang, Windlass Steelcrafts Maciejowski "Warbrand" sword. I paid extra for the sharpening service, and it cuts through beach mats with ease (which is more than can be said for my stainless full tang katana).

The new set of high quality Kendo armor I am gradually putting together to replace my aging cheap set. So far just it's just the Tare but I would like to get new kote soon (holes are forming in the palm leathers).

I have been taking Kendo for about five years now and currently hold the rank of Nikkyu (brown belt as I recall, we don't actually wear colored belts in Kendo).
